The Law of Three Stages

The document outlines Auguste Comte's Law of Three Stages, which states that societies and sciences progress through theological, metaphysical, and positive stages. [1] The theological stage involves explaining phenomena through religion and personified deities. [2] The metaphysical stage sees an extension of theology through abstract concepts like God as an impersonal force. [3] Finally, the positive stage relies on scientific explanation and the scientific method based on observation and experimentation.

The Law of Three Stage
 The law of three stages is an idea developed by Auguste
Comte in his work The Course in Positive Philosophy. It
states that society as a whole, and each particular science,
develops through three mentally conceived stages:

the theological
stage

the metaphysical
stage

the positive stage

• The Theological stage refers to the appeal to personified

Theolgical Stage deities. During the earlier stages, people believed that all the
phenomena of nature are the creation of the divine or
supernatural.

• Fetishism was the primary stage of the theological stage of


Fetishism thinking. Throughout this stage, primitive people believe that
inanimate objects have living spirit in them, also known as
animism.

• At one poin, Fetishism began to bring about doubt in the minds of its
believers. As a result, people turned towards polytheism: The explation of
Polytheism things through the use of many Gods. Primitive people believe that all
natural forces are controlled by different Gods; a few example would be
God of water, God of rain, God of fire, God of air, God of earth, etc.

Monotheism •Monotheism means believing in one God or God in one;


attributing all to a single, supreme deity. Primitive people believe a
single theistic entity is responsible for the existence of the
universe.
•The Metaphysical stage is an extension of the

Metaphys theological stage. It refers to explanation by


impersonal abstract concepts. People often try to
characterize God as an abstract being. They
ical Stage believe that an abstract power or force guides and
determines events in the world.

Positiv
•The Positivity stage, also known as the scientific stage,
refers to scientific explanation based on observation,
experiment, and comparison. Positive explanations
rely upon a distinct method, the scientific method, for

e Stage their justification. Today people attempt to establish


cause and effect relationships.
